TERRE HAUTE, Ind. (WTWO/WAWV) — Dozens of local non-profits received grants on Wednesday thanks to the generosity of four Terre Haute citizens who established trusts.
First Financial Bank distributed funds to 52 non-profit organizations. The bank awarded a total of $116,000 in which the contributions come from trusts established by Oscar Baur, Frederick Benson, Mary Smith Young, and Sheldon Swope.
Carol Myers is the Vice President and Senior Trust Officer of First Financial Bank. Myers said it’s amazing how many people these trusts have helped over the years.
“They established these trusts to help preserve and help the people of the Wabash Valley and particularly Vigo County,” says Myers. “The poor, the disadvantaged, basically any charitable organization.”
